WampServer 自带 PHP 环境,无需手动配置即可运行项目;如需命令行调用 php、修改 php.ini 或切换版本,须分别设置系统环境变量、编辑对应 php.ini 并重启服务、通过托盘菜单切换版本。

WampServer 自带 PHP 环境,无需手动配置 PHP 路径即可直接运行 PHP 项目。但如果你需要切换 PHP 版本、修改 PHP 配置(php.ini)、或让命令行(CMD/PowerShell)也能识别 php 命令,则需针对性设置路径和选项。
一、确认 WampServer 中的 PHP 安装位置
WampServer 默认将 PHP 安装在以下路径(以安装在 C 盘为例):
-
C:\wamp64\bin\php\php{版本号}\(如
php8.2.12) - 该目录下包含
php.exe、php.ini、扩展 DLL 文件等
你可以在 WampServer 系统托盘图标 → PHP → Version 中查看当前启用的 PHP 版本,对应的就是正在使用的文件夹。
二、让 CMD/PowerShell 能直接运行 php 命令
这是“配置 PHP 环境变量”的核心目的——使终端能全局调用 php -v 或 php --ini。
立即学习“PHP免费学习笔记(深入)”;
- 右键“此电脑” → “属性” → “高级系统设置” → “环境变量”
- 在“系统变量”中找到 Path,点击“编辑” → “新建”
- 添加路径:
C:\wamp64\bin\php\php8.2.12\(请替换为你当前启用的 PHP 版本文件夹) - 保存后,重启 CMD 或 PowerShell,输入
php -v验证是否生效
三、修改 PHP 配置(php.ini)
WampServer 提供两种方式快速编辑 php.ini:
- 左键点击托盘图标 → PHP → php.ini(打开的是当前启用版本的配置文件)
- 或进入对应 PHP 目录,手动编辑
php.ini(推荐使用“php.ini-development”副本并重命名为 php.ini) - 常见修改项:
extension_dir(扩展路径,Wamp 通常已设好)、date.timezone = "Asia/Shanghai"、开启扩展如extension=mysqli、extension=openssl - 改完保存后,必须重启所有 Wamp 服务(托盘图标 → Restart All Services)才生效
四、切换 PHP 版本(多版本共存)
WampServer 支持一键切换 PHP 版本,无需手动改环境变量:
- 确保你已下载并安装多个 PHP 版本(通过 WampServer 官网或集成包)
- 托盘图标 → PHP → Version → 点击目标版本(带勾表示已启用)
- 自动更新 Apache 的 PHP 模块,并刷新 php.ini 关联
- 注意:命令行中的
php仍走系统 Path 里指定的路径,如需同步,需手动更新 Path
不复杂但容易忽略:WampServer 是集成环境,大部分 PHP 运行依赖由它内部管理;只有当你需要命令行开发、Composer 使用、或调试 CLI 脚本时,才真正需要配置系统级 PHP 路径。











